Make UI build optional

This commit is contained in:
Sébastien
2023-09-30 23:33:04 -04:00
committed by GitHub
parent cd76619e96
commit d2d0cadeed

View File

@@ -34,12 +34,13 @@ jobs:
uses: einaregilsson/build-number@v3 uses: einaregilsson/build-number@v3
with: with:
token: ${{secrets.github_token}} token: ${{secrets.github_token}}
- name: Set build flags - name: Set build flags
id: build_flags id: build_flags
run: | run: |
git config --global --add safe.directory /__w/squeezelite-esp32/squeezelite-esp32 git config --global --add safe.directory /__w/squeezelite-esp32/squeezelite-esp32
[ ${{github.event.inputs.ui_build}} ] && ui_build_option="--ui_build" || ui_build_option="" [ "${{github.event.inputs.ui_build}}" == "1" ] && ui_build_option="--ui_build" || ui_build_option=""
[ ${{github.event.inputs.release_build}} ] && release_build_option="--force" || release_build_option="" [ "${{github.event.inputs.release_build}}" == "1" ] && release_build_option="--force" || release_build_option=""
echo "ui_build_option=$ui_build_option" >> $GITHUB_ENV echo "ui_build_option=$ui_build_option" >> $GITHUB_ENV
echo "release_build_option=$release_build_option" >> $GITHUB_ENV echo "release_build_option=$release_build_option" >> $GITHUB_ENV
echo "Dumping environment" echo "Dumping environment"